What is Xenical?

Xenical is a potent, specific, and long-acting gastrointestinal lipase inhibitor. Unlike lots of weight reduction supplements that function as stimulants or appetite suppressants, Xenical does not impact the central nerve system. Instead, it works straight within the gastrointestinal system to avoid the absorption of a portion of the fat consumed in the diet.

The active ingredient, Orlistat, is offered in 2 primary strengths:

  1. Xenical (120mg): This is the prescription-strength variation.
  2. Alli (60mg): This is the lower-dose version, which is typically available over-the-counter (OTC) in lots of nations.

Mechanism of Action

When an individual consumes a meal including fat, enzymes called lipases break down the fat into smaller sized elements so the body can absorb them. When  Generic Xenical Germany  is taken with a meal, it connects itself to these enzymes, preventing them from doing their task. As an outcome, roughly 25% to 30% of the fat consumed in a meal passes through the body undigested and is eliminated through bowel motions.

Who Is a Candidate for Xenical?

Xenical is not planned for people who want to lose a couple of pounds for cosmetic reasons. It is a medical treatment designed for those with medical weight concerns.

Requirements for Use:

  • BMI Requirements: Typically, Xenical is recommended for individuals with a Body Mass Index (BMI) of 30 or greater (obese).
  • Comorbidities: It might be prescribed for those with a BMI of 27 or greater if they likewise have weight-related health conditions such as type 2 diabetes, hypertension, or high cholesterol.
  • Dietary Commitment: It must be utilized in combination with a slightly hypocaloric, low-fat diet plan.

Negative Effects and Management

Due to the fact that Xenical works by obstructing fat absorption, the most typical negative effects are gastrointestinal (GI) in nature. These are frequently referred to as "treatment impacts" due to the fact that they are a direct outcome of the medication's mechanism.

Typical Side Effects

  • Oily identifying in undergarments.
  • Flatulence with discharge.
  • Immediate requirement to have a bowel motion.
  • Oily or fatty stools.
  • Increased variety of bowel movements.

Handling Side Effects

The severity of these negative effects is directly linked to the amount of fat in the diet. If a user eats a meal very high in fat, the signs will be more noticable.

A Low-Fat Dietary Guide:

  • Total Fat Intake: Approximately 30% of daily calories should come from fat.
  • Circulation: Fat intake must be spread evenly over 3 main meals.
  • Food Choices: Lean proteins (chicken, fish), whole grains, fruits, and vegetables are motivated.

Essential Safety Information and Contraindications

Not everyone can securely utilize Xenical. It is essential to consult a health care expert-- even through an online consultation-- to eliminate contraindications.

Who Should Avoid Xenical?

  1. Pregnancy and Breastfeeding: Xenical is not recommended for pregnant or nursing women.
  2. Persistent Malabsorption Syndrome: Individuals who have difficulty soaking up nutrients.
  3. Cholestasis: A condition where bile flow from the liver is obstructed.
  4. Kidney Issues: Those with a history of kidney stones or chronic kidney illness need to utilize caution.
  5. Cyclosporine Users: Xenical can hinder the absorption of anti-rejection medications.

Vitamin Supplementation

Since Xenical obstructs the absorption of some fats, it can also prevent the absorption of fat-soluble vitamins (A, D, E, and K). Users are usually encouraged to take a multivitamin supplement at bedtime (at least 2 hours after taking Xenical) to make sure dietary balance.

VitaminRole in the Body
Vitamin AVision and immune function
Vitamin DBone health and calcium absorption
Vitamin EAntioxidant and skin health
Vitamin KBlood clot and bone metabolic process

Often Asked Questions (FAQ)

1. Just how much weight can I expect to lose on Xenical?

Medical trials recommend that when combined with a low-fat diet, numerous users can lose 5% to 10% of their preliminary body weight within the first year of treatment.

2. Is Xenical a cravings suppressant?

No. Xenical does not indicate the brain to feel complete. It just works on the enzymes in the gut to block fat absorption.

3. Can I take Xenical if I am on other medications?

Orlistat can interact with several medications, consisting of blood thinners (Warfarin), thyroid medications (Levothyroxine), and anti-epileptic drugs. Constantly reveal all present medications during your assessment.

4. What happens if I consume a really high-fat meal?

If you consume a meal with excessive fat (e.g., fried food or heavy cream), you are extremely likely to experience "oily leak," diarrhea, and intense gas. The drug functions as a "behavioral modifier" by preventing high-fat options.
